JTC1 Chair’s Goals for Vancouver
November 2005 JTC1 Chair’s Goals for Vancouver Report current status of JTC1 fast tracks 1N7903 and 1N7904 Identify volunteers to develop supporting materials for application to become registration authority Identify volunteers to develop additional comments for the 1N7903 and 1N7904 fast track ballots Identify volunteers to develop response to China’s Contradictions submission on 1N7903 (802.11i) Identify volunteers to create another outreach letter inviting China to join our process Identify volunteers to draft a PAR to harmonize 1N7904 with ma-REV Approve v8 Jesse Walker, Intel Corporation
4
November 2005 Accomplishments Current status of JTC1 fast tracks 1N7903 and 1N7904 reported Identified volunteers to develop supporting materials for application to become registration authority by January 2006 to develop additional comments for the 1N7903 and 1N7904 fast track ballots by January 2006 to develop response to China’s Contradictions submission on 1N7903 (802.11i) by March 2006 to create another outreach letter inviting China to join our process by March 2006 Revised v8 to v9 and sent to WG for adoption Submitted v0 to publish comments on 1N7904 and sent to WG and ExCom for approval The SC6 Study Group met but received no WLAN requirements from SC6, so adjourned Jesse Walker, Intel Corporation

Goals for Waikoloa (January 2006)
November 2005 Goals for Waikoloa (January 2006) JTC1 Ad Hoc Update to provide additional comments on JTC1 Document 1N7904 and approve for transmittal to JTC1 Complete and approve request to become JTC1 Registration Authority for ISO/IEC SC6 SG Goals Receive WLAN requirements from JTC1/SC6 Jesse Walker, Intel Corporation
